news 2026/6/10 7:36:16

5分钟搭建map遍历原型

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
5分钟搭建map遍历原型

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    快速创建一个map遍历概念验证原型,展示核心功能和用户体验。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在开发中经常需要处理map数据结构,但每次写demo验证遍历逻辑都要从头搭建环境实在太麻烦。直到发现InsCode(快马)平台可以快速创建运行原型,终于能专注在核心逻辑上了。下面分享我的实践过程,带你5分钟搞定map遍历验证。

为什么需要快速原型

  1. 验证思路的捷径:当想到一个新的map处理算法时,最怕花半天时间配置环境,结果发现思路根本不可行
  2. 避免过度工程化:简单的遍历测试不需要完整项目结构,原型只要核心逻辑能跑通就行
  3. 即时反馈调整:快速看到运行结果可以立即优化迭代,比空想效率高得多

三步创建map遍历原型

  1. 确定验证目标:比如这次我想测试用不同方式遍历map时对性能的影响,重点关注forEach vs for...of的使用场景差异

  2. 选择合适的数据集:在平台直接定义测试数据,包括简单对象、嵌套对象、大数据量对象三种情况

  3. 编写核心逻辑:只保留最关键的遍历代码,去掉所有无关的异常处理和边缘情况判断,保持代码足够聚焦

原型设计的技巧

  • 单一职责:每个原型只验证一个具体问题,比如这次就专注遍历方式对比
  • 可视化输出:用console.table()清晰展示遍历结果,比单纯log更直观
  • 性能标记:用performance.now()记录不同方法的执行时间

在InsCode上的实际体验

  1. 打开网页直接开箱即用,不用配置Node环境
  2. 左侧写代码右侧实时看到输出结果,调试循环逻辑特别方便
  3. 一键运行后,控制台直接显示表格化的遍历结果和执行时间对比

意想不到的收获

通过快速原型发现: 1. 对于小规模数据,各种遍历方式差异不大 2. 当map的size超过1万时,for...of开始明显优于forEach 3. 嵌套map结构用递归+for...of组合最合适

这些发现在完整项目中可能需要大量测试才能得出结论,而用原型几分钟就能验证。

推荐使用场景

  1. 面试前突击复习map相关API
  2. 教学演示不同遍历方法的区别
  3. 开发新功能前的技术预研
  4. 性能优化的前期摸底测试

最后不得不说,InsCode(快马)平台这种即开即用的体验太适合快速验证想法了。不用折腾环境配置,专注在核心逻辑上,5分钟就能从概念到可运行的原型,效率提升不是一点半点。特别是写完后可以直接分享链接给同事讨论,省去了传文件的麻烦。

如果你也经常需要快速测试一些编程想法,强烈建议收藏这个工具,下次验证map或者其他数据结构操作时,绝对能帮你节省大量时间。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    快速创建一个map遍历概念验证原型,展示核心功能和用户体验。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/10 10:11:33

Apache ECharts数据筛选:3个核心技巧让你的图表交互体验提升300%

你是否曾经面对密密麻麻的图表数据感到无从下手?想要快速找到关键信息却只能手动筛选?别担心,Apache ECharts的数据筛选功能就是你的救星!今天,我将带你掌握3个核心技巧,让你的数据可视化瞬间升级为专业级交…

作者头像 李华
网站建设 2026/6/10 14:15:30

27、Linux 系统打印与程序编译全攻略

Linux 系统打印与程序编译全攻略 在 Linux 系统中,打印和程序编译是两项重要的操作。下面将详细介绍如何在 Linux 系统中进行打印操作以及如何编译程序。 打印操作 在类 Unix 系统中,CUPS 打印套件支持两种历史上常用的打印方法,分别使用 lpr 和 lp 程序。 1. 使用 …

作者头像 李华
网站建设 2026/6/10 2:44:49

35、流量控制与字符串数字处理:for 循环及参数扩展详解

流量控制与字符串数字处理:for 循环及参数扩展详解 1. for 循环 在编程中,for 循环是一种强大的工具,用于处理序列。在现代版本的 bash 中,for 循环有两种形式。 1.1 传统 shell 形式 传统的 for 命令语法如下: for variable [in words]; docommands done其中, va…

作者头像 李华
网站建设 2026/6/10 14:15:16

21、正则表达式入门与元字符详解

正则表达式入门与元字符详解 1. 哈希表遍历 1.1 按预定义顺序遍历哈希表 若要按键插入哈希表的顺序遍历键,需维护一个单独的数组来存储这些键。每次向哈希表添加键时,也要将该键添加到数组中。示例代码如下: my @keys_in_order; my %hash; $hash{thing} = 1; push @key…

作者头像 李华
网站建设 2026/6/10 14:16:05

AutoGPT如何生成Word文档?python-docx调用指南

AutoGPT如何生成Word文档?python-docx调用指南 在当今AI驱动的自动化浪潮中,一个真正“能思考、会动手”的智能体已不再是科幻设想。设想这样一个场景:你只需告诉AI——“帮我写一份关于Python学习计划的报告”,几秒钟后&#xff…

作者头像 李华
网站建设 2026/6/10 13:02:53

鸿蒙PC UI控件库 - TextArea 多行文本输入详解

演示视频地址: https://www.bilibili.com/video/BV1jomdBBE4H/ 📋 目录 概述特性快速开始API 参考使用示例主题配置最佳实践常见问题总结 概述 TextArea 是控件库中的多行文本输入组件,支持字数统计、自动调整高度、验证等功能&#xff…

作者头像 李华